The use of SETI might be questionable but they are the only DC project that works on non OS X mac computers.! RC-72 does not have a classic client any more.
Of the various OS X projects only fold@home seem to be running smoothly.
Ubero and Distributed folding is parked and Predictor is as I understand about to be restarted.
I have given up on D2OL when the client broke one time to many with a update of Java, OS, Client, Something
Well I am thinking about getting a PC for Half-Life 2 and such, then I will have more options for DC
